#c1d0c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c1d0cc is composed of 75.7% red, 81.6%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.9%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 164 degrees, a saturation of 13.8% and a lightness of 78.6%. #c1d0c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#83a199.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#c1d0cc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040505 is the darkest color, while #f9fafa is the lightest one.
